There’s currently no basket on hole 8 and the one on 6 is struggling a bit but it’s still there. It’s almost a quarter mile walk from hole 5 to 6. Super wide open and not a ton of shot variety, but still not too bad of a course, just pretty boring.

I’m used to wooded courses so this was an enjoyable difference. There are a lot of long shots, and they’re close to the tree line so it requires some touch, and skill with the turnover shot. Definitely bring your walking shoes, and throwing arm.

Definitely a field work course if you want to walk that much. First half hard to get birdies, back half easier with the longer pars. Course could use a major redesign and cut into some of the woods (depending on property lines). Or add a few more holes and make it a 13 hole course. Baskets are set lower than regulation. Neat swimming hole between 6 and 7.

This is a driving range, plain and simple. Most every hole is straight ahead with no obstacles. That being said, the grounds are well maintained and the signage is clear. There is quite a long walk between holes 5 and 6, but there was a path mowed so that you don’t have to walk through any tall grass. No teepads was disappointing, but there was plenty of level ground to play from at each hole.
